Remote/Local Mode
Remote/Local Mode
Description
Remote Mode
When the test set is operated remotely, all of the keys on the front panel of the test set are disabled (except the
LOCAL key and the power switch). During remote operation the test set is controlled by the Remote User
Interface, (RUI).
Any open menus are be closed, and any manual entries are be aborted when the test set transitions from local
mode to remote mode.
The remote annunciator (R) will appear in the Instrument Status Area of the test set's display indicating that
the test set is in remote mode.
When the test set is in remote mode press the LOCAL key on the front panel in order to gain manual control.
Local Mode
During local mode all front panel keys and the knob are enabled. During local operation the test set is
controlled by the Manual User Interface, (MUI).
The remote annunciator (R) is turned off when the test set is operated in local mode.
